Science Teacher – Secondary School – Wandsworth – Permanent

Are you a dedicated and passionate Science Teacher seeking a new opportunity in a thriving Wandsworth secondary school?

A highly reputable secondary school in the vibrant borough of Wandsworth is seeking a talented and enthusiastic Science Teacher to join their successful Science department on a full-time, permanent basis. This is an excellent opportunity for a qualified Science Teacher to contribute to a supportive and dynamic learning environment.

The Role:

  • Planning and delivering engaging Science lessons to students across Key Stages 3 and 4 (KS3/4).
  • Assessing student progress and providing constructive feedback to foster academic development.
  • Collaborating with colleagues to develop and enhance the Science curriculum.
  • Maintaining a stimulating and well-managed classroom environment that promotes learning.
  • Staying up-to-date with current developments in Science education and teaching methodologies.

Candidate Profile: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Science or a related field.
  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ent teaching qualification.
  • Proven experience teaching Science at the secondary school level (KS3/4).
  • A strong commitment to delivering high-quality Science education.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to build positive relationships with students and colleagues.

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ary in accordance with the Main Pay Scale/Upper Pay Scale (MPS/UPS) – Inner London weighting.
  • A supportive and collaborative working environment within a well-resourced Science department.
  • Opportunities for professional development and career progression.
  • The chance to make a real difference in the lives of young people.
